Meet Nura Afia, the first Hijab-wearing face of international cosmetics brand Cover Girl. To the rest of the Internet universe, Afia is known for her makeup guides on YouTube.
In her channel she shows tutorials on how ladies, especially those that wear hijabs, can spruce up their looks because let's face it - every woman deserves to look and feel gorgeous.
Afia's appointment as Cover Girl's new brand ambassador stems from worldwide brands moving on to become more diverse in their approach with advertising, touching on varied culture groups and genders. Before Afia, Cover Girl even signed in its first male ambassador, James Charles.
Speaking about her appointment and future campaigns with the brand, a Guardian report quoted her as saying: "I hope [this campaign] will show Muslim women that brands care about us as consumers and we're important, especially hijabis," Afia said. "We can be featured on TV, can be featured on billboards in Times Square, can be represented."
Nura, which goes by the handle of Babylailalov on YouTube is part of an emerging group of Muslim beauty bloggers that are making waves on social media. Here's some of our favourite looks from the newly appointed ambassadress:
